Job Description

Welcome to Select Medical, a leading healthcare company that is dedicated to providing exceptional care and service to our patients. We are currently seeking a highly skilled and motivated Director of Case Management to join our team. As the Director of Case Management, you will play a crucial role in overseeing and managing the case management department, ensuring that our patients receive the best possible care and outcomes. We are looking for a dynamic individual with a strong background in case management and leadership, who is passionate about making a positive impact on the lives of our patients. If you are a driven and compassionate individual with the required qualifications, we invite you to apply for this exciting opportunity.

  1. Oversee and manage the case management department, ensuring all operations run smoothly and efficiently.
  2. Develop and implement strategies to improve the overall quality of patient care and outcomes.
  3. Monitor and evaluate the performance of the case management team, providing coaching and feedback as needed.
  4. Collaborate with other departments and healthcare professionals to ensure coordinated and comprehensive care for patients.
  5. Stay up-to-date on industry trends and best practices in case management to continuously improve processes and procedures.
  6. Develop and maintain relationships with key stakeholders, including patients, families, and healthcare providers.
  7. Maintain accurate and thorough records of patient care and outcomes, ensuring compliance with all regulatory requirements.
  8. Advocate for patients and their families, ensuring their needs and preferences are considered in the case management process.
  9. Develop and manage the department budget, ensuring resources are allocated effectively.
  10. Lead and motivate the case management team, fostering a positive and supportive work environment.
  11. Participate in the recruitment, hiring, and training of new case management staff.
  12. Handle any escalated issues or concerns related to patient care and outcomes.
  13. Conduct regular performance evaluations and provide ongoing professional development opportunities for the case management team.
  14. Serve as a role model for ethical and professional behavior, adhering to all company policies and procedures.
  15. Collaborate with other departments to implement and maintain company-wide initiatives and goals.

Job Qualifications
  • Minimum Of 5 Years Experience In A Leadership Role In Case Management Or Healthcare Administration.

  • Bachelor's Degree In Nursing, Healthcare Management, Or Related Field. Master's Degree Preferred.

  • Strong Understanding Of Healthcare Laws And Regulations, Including Medicare And Medicaid Guidelines.

  • Excellent Communication And Interpersonal Skills, With The Ability To Collaborate With Multiple Departments And Stakeholders.

  • Proven Track Record Of Implementing And Managing Successful Case Management Programs, With A Focus On Quality Improvement And Cost Reduction.

Compensation

According to JobzMall, the average salary range for a Director of Case Management in Miami, FL, USA is $87,000 - $120,000 per year. However, salary may vary depending on factors such as years of experience, education level, and size of the organization. Additionally, bonuses and benefits may also impact the overall salary package.

About Select Medical

Select Medical is a healthcare company with approximately 36,050 employees throughout the United States. It owns long term acute care and inpatient rehabilitation hospitals, as well as occupational health and physical therapy clinics.
